Gillingham (Kent) railway station

Gillingham (Kent) railway station in the town of Gillingham, north Kent, is on the Chatham Main Line between Chatham and Rainham stations. Train services are provided by Southeastern. The distance from London Victoria station plated on the footbridge at the western end of the platforms is 35 miles and 67 chains. The station first opened in 1858.It currently has three platforms (two for London bound services and one for coast bound services) and a passenger lift from the station entrance to the lower platforms.
